Course abstract

Master students acquire knowledge, skills and reflection abilities on theoretical and empirical kinds of researches and methods, valuation of their accordance to researches, criteria of choices of methods.

Learning outcomes and their assessment

Knowledge: on types of theoretical and empirical investigations, their planning and ethics, cooperation with psychologists, ascertaining of information necessary for the investigations, as well as possibilities of non-formal and informal education for complementation of knowledge; skills: to plan the investigation, choose and evaluate information necessary for investigations and data obtaining and processing methods ethically, to implement adaptation and approbations of the methods, competence: to carry out the investigation in cooperation with psychologists taking a responsibility of its ethics to work out methodologies of counseling and prepare publications, to develop the competence of research methodology using the possibilities of informal education, to choose types of continuing education and research problems.
